ITC, a largecap company in the cigarettes/tobacco industry, has recently been downgraded to a 'Hold' by MarketsMOJO on August 26, 2024. This decision was based on various factors, including the company's strong long-term fundamental strength with an average Return on Equity (ROE) of 23.77%, healthy long-term growth with an annual net sales growth rate of 7.46%, and a low debt to equity ratio of 0 times.

Technically, the stock is currently in a mildly bullish range, with multiple factors such as MACD, Bollinger Band, and KST indicating a bullish trend. Additionally, the company has a high institutional holding of 84.53%, which suggests that these investors have better capabilities and resources to analyze the company's fundamentals compared to retail investors.

However, the company's recent financial results for June 2024 were flat, and its ROE of 27.5 indicates a very expensive valuation with a price to book value of 8.5. The stock is currently trading at a fair value compared to its average historical valuations. In the past year, while the stock has generated a return of 13.93%, its profits have only risen by 3%, resulting in a high PEG ratio of 12.9.

Furthermore, ITC has underperformed the market in the last year, with a return of 13.93% compared to the market's (BSE 500) return of 39.36%. This could be a cause for concern for investors, as the company's performance has not been able to keep up with the overall market.

In conclusion, while ITC has strong long-term fundamentals and a bullish technical outlook, its recent financial results and expensive valuation may have led to its downgrade to a 'Hold' by MarketsMOJO.
